This patch removes the following unused EXPORT_SYMBOL's: - console_printk - is_console_locked - __printk_ratelimit
Signed-off-by: Adrian Bunk <bunk@stusta.de>
---
This patch was already sent on: - 1 May 2006 - 18 Apr 2006 - 11 Apr 2006
kernel/printk.c | 4 ---- 1 file changed, 4 deletions(-)
--- linux-2.6.17-rc1-mm2-full/kernel/printk.c.old 2006-04-11 01:20:32.000000000 +0200 +++ linux-2.6.17-rc1-mm2-full/kernel/printk.c 2006-04-11 01:21:54.000000000 +0200 @@ -52,8 +52,6 @@ DEFAULT_CONSOLE_LOGLEVEL, /* default_console_loglevel */ }; -EXPORT_SYMBOL(console_printk); - /* * Low lever drivers may need that to know if they can schedule in * their unblank() callback or not.
